Output 8dd5bb6a24cd86ae78c9da06afbab668b6e9636d9622784dbe8962aabc010d59: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8eacc1c8fa8009b946b50ac4823c70ad1bd7a62 OP_EQUAL
address
3MTy9yvet9Q8ZSMJ5DovEvbjdE2qQn6A5U
transaction
8dd5bb6a24cd86ae78c9da06afbab668b6e9636d9622784dbe8962aabc010d59
spent
true